How to Select Appropriate Large Diameter Hoses
When purchasing large diameter hoses, choose based on your specific needs and working conditions. For transporting corrosive substances, go for anti-corrosion hoses. If you’ll be using them in high-temperature environments, pick hoses with excellent heat resistance. Also, consider steel-wire-reinforced rubber pipes for added safety and reliability.
Large-diameter heavy-duty rubber hoses are generally tough and dependable. However, that doesn’t mean you can use them without care. Proper usage and regular maintenance are essential.

Here are some key points for using large-diameter hoses:
Sealing Test
Always test the hoses for sealing performance first. This ensures they won’t leak water or air during operation.
Avoid Bending and Squeezing
Don’t bend or squeeze the rubber hoses for extended periods. Such actions can cause deformation and damage.
Prevent Damage
While in use, make sure the hoses don’t get rolled over. This helps keep them in good condition and ensures safe operation.
